Net Ionic Equation The balanced net ionic equation includes only species that are involved in the reaction. It can be found by removing ions that occur on both the reactant and product side of the complete ionic equation. Mg(OH)2(s) + 2H+(aq) = Mg2+(aq) + 2H2O(l) ...
